Matam vs Naia, Mai (Pasay City) Climate & Distance Between

Philippines flag
  • The distance between Matam, Senegal and Naia, Mai (Pasay City), Philippines is approximately 13,974 km or 8,684 mi.
  • To reach Matam in this distance one would set out from Naia, Mai (Pasay City) bearing 301.9° or WNW and follow the great circles arc to approach Matam bearing 238.6° or WSW .
  • Matam has a subtropical hot desert climate (BWh) whereas Naia, Mai (Pasay City) has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w).
  • Matam is in or near the tropical very dry forest biome whereas Naia, Mai (Pasay City) is in or near the tropical moist forest biome.
  • The mean temperature is 2.4 °C (4.3°F) warmer.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 6.8 °C (12.2°F) more in Matam. The continentality subtype is barely hyperoceanic as opposed to truly hyperoceanic.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 1510 mm (59.4 in) less which is equivalent to 1510 l/m² (37.06 US gal/ft²) or 15,100,000 l/ha (1,614,290 US gal/ac) less. About 1/5 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 0.5° lower in Matam than in Naia, Mai (Pasay City).
